Robert Downey Jr. has been making major headlines this week, at the crossroads of Hollywood, business, and fandom. On the cinematic front, anticipation is off the charts for his return to the Marvel Cinematic Universe but not as Tony Stark. According to coverage from multiple industry sources, Robert will be playing Victor Von Doom better known as Doctor Doom in Avengers Doomsday set for release in December 2026. This marks a dramatic reinvention for Downey Jr. and signals a new era for Marvel, especially as the first family of superheroes the Fantastic Four and other characters are integrated into the main MCU timeline. Industry site AOL highlights that his turn as Doctor Doom is set to be a "centerpiece" with considerable focus on the tragedy and complexity of the character. In fact, The Russo Brothers have been dropping cryptic social media teasers via AGBO Films, showing imagery of Iron Man and Doctor Doom masks, and sparking wild theories about a deeper narrative connection between his two roles. Rumors are circulating about the first Avengers Doomsday trailer possibly arriving by the end of the year, with insiders like Film Threat describing early cuts in which Downey’s Doctor Doom is presented as a masked, wounded and almost gothic figure channeling classic Universal Monsters like The Phantom of the Opera. While early leaks are fueling speculation, nothing official has been confirmed by Marvel, so fans are left buzzing and dissecting every frame and mask reveal.
Beyond the movie lot, Downey Jr. just announced a collaboration with his longtime MCU co-star Tom Holland. Variety and AOL report that the two have launched a new limited-edition beverage partnership blending Holland’s nonalcoholic beer brand Bero with Downey’s Happy Coffee, resulting in a Bero Coffee Draught and a signature Eternal Hoptimist coffee. Available online and at select national retailers, this joint venture is being pitched as a reflection of their real-life friendship and shared values, and it’s drawing attention on both their social channels. Holland and Downey are both scheduled to appear in Avengers Doomsday, fueling even more crossover excitement for their off-screen and on-screen reunions.
